How It Begins
This path begins with how we live — by reducing harm in speech, action, and mind. From that foundation, the mind becomes steadier. Through mindfulness, meditation, and investigation, concentration and wisdom naturally develop.
The foundation of the path. Reducing harm in how we speak, act, and employ our mind, and cultivating positive mental qualities. An ethical life supports a peaceful mind.
Training the mind to be present with the objects of meditation. Watching the arising and passing away of experience, concentration and wisdom naturally develop.
Investigating the nature of phenomena — seeing clearly that they are impermanent, unsatisfying, and not truly ours to hold. From that investigation, wisdom naturally arises — resulting in direct knowledge and vision.

I was born in Afghanistan and came to the United States because of the conflict. Like so many others, I am no stranger to suffering — and I searched for a way out of it. I came to understand that intellectual knowledge alone, and rites and rituals, were not leading me toward lasting peace or freedom.
That search brought me to meditation and to the teachings of those who were self-realized and enlightened. What I found was an ancient, practical path that has helped me understand suffering and, gradually, find freedom from it.
I am not a teacher. I do not claim authority. I am simply someone who was lucky enough to find something that works — as others have found before me.
I hold a master's degree in political science. I have seen people with PhDs and titles — deeply knowledgeable — who still suffer, whose knowledge has itself become part of their burden. And I have seen ordinary people suffering quietly every day. What I have come to understand is that the root is always the same: not truly understanding ourselves through first-hand experience, the nature of our experience, and the nature of the world.
This website exists because I want to share what I have found — a path discovered and walked by those who were fully enlightened, particularly Gautama Buddha. I share it not as someone who has arrived, but as a fellow traveler who has walked a bit of the way. It has worked for me. It has worked for millions across centuries. Come and test it for yourself.
